How To Fix LRM_RULE_EXEC565 - Policy &1 is a non-production policy


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: LRM_RULE_EXEC - Runtime

  • Message number: 565

  • Message text: Policy &1 is a non-production policy

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message LRM_RULE_EXEC565 - Policy &1 is a non-production policy ?

    The SAP error message LRM_RULE_EXEC565 indicates that a specific policy, referred to as Policy &1, is classified as a non-production policy. This typically occurs in the context of SAP Landscape Management (LaMa) or similar systems where policies are used to manage system landscapes.

    Cause:

    The error arises when an operation is attempted on a non-production policy that is not allowed or is restricted to production policies. Non-production policies are generally used for development, testing, or quality assurance environments, and certain actions may be limited to production policies only.

    Solution:

    To resolve this error, consider the following steps:

    1. Check Policy Type: Verify the type of policy you are trying to execute. Ensure that the operation you are attempting is appropriate for a non-production policy.

    2. Use a Production Policy: If the operation requires a production policy, you may need to create or switch to a production policy that meets the requirements of the operation you are trying to perform.

    3. Modify Policy Settings: If you have the necessary permissions, you may be able to modify the settings of the non-production policy to allow the desired operation, but this is generally not recommended unless you are certain of the implications.

    4. Consult Documentation: Review the SAP documentation related to landscape management and policies to understand the limitations and capabilities of non-production versus production policies.

    5. Contact Support: If you are unsure about how to proceed or if the issue persists, consider reaching out to SAP support or your internal SAP administrator for assistance.
